    You have next to no chance getting a turbo kit on a pre-VE engineered in VIC, from an emissions perspective.

    GEN-TT kits require a fair bit of hacking and bending to make fit, if you are keen on twins check out the ASE twin turbo kits instead. Otherwise, GenRacing and ASE make nice single turbo kits.

    If I had my time again I wouldn't go turbo. I still don't have the confidence to walk away from my car after a drive without checking if it is on fire...
